Subject: [PATCH V4 2/5] ARM: EXYNOS4: Add FIMD resource definition

From: Jonghun Han <jonghun.han@samsung.com>

This patch adds resource definitions for EXYNOS4 FIMD.
IRQ and SFR definitions are added.

Signed-off-by: Jonghun Han <jonghun.han@samsung.com>
Signed-off-by: Jingoo Han <jg1.han@samsung.com>
---
 arch/arm/mach-exynos4/include/mach/irqs.h |    8 ++++++++
 arch/arm/mach-exynos4/include/mach/map.h  |    5 +++++
 2 files changed, 13 insertions(+), 0 deletions(-)

diff --git a/arch/arm/mach-exynos4/include/mach/irqs.h b/arch/arm/mach-exynos4/include/mach/irqs.h
index 5d03730..2cd2090 100644
--- a/arch/arm/mach-exynos4/include/mach/irqs.h
+++ b/arch/arm/mach-exynos4/include/mach/irqs.h
@@ -73,6 +73,14 @@
 #define IRQ_SYSMMU_MFC_M1_0	COMBINER_IRQ(5, 6)
 #define IRQ_SYSMMU_PCIE_0	COMBINER_IRQ(5, 7)
 
+#define IRQ_FIMD0_FIFO		COMBINER_IRQ(11, 0)
+#define IRQ_FIMD0_VSYNC		COMBINER_IRQ(11, 1)
+#define IRQ_FIMD0_SYSTEM	COMBINER_IRQ(11, 2)
+
+#define IRQ_FIMD1_FIFO		COMBINER_IRQ(12, 0)
+#define IRQ_FIMD1_VSYNC		COMBINER_IRQ(12, 1)
+#define IRQ_FIMD1_SYSTEM	COMBINER_IRQ(12, 2)
+
 #define IRQ_PDMA0		COMBINER_IRQ(21, 0)
 #define IRQ_PDMA1		COMBINER_IRQ(21, 1)
 
diff --git a/arch/arm/mach-exynos4/include/mach/map.h b/arch/arm/mach-exynos4/include/mach/map.h
index 0009e77..94006f7 100644
--- a/arch/arm/mach-exynos4/include/mach/map.h
+++ b/arch/arm/mach-exynos4/include/mach/map.h
@@ -93,6 +93,9 @@
 #define EXYNOS4_PA_MIPI_CSIS0		0x11880000
 #define EXYNOS4_PA_MIPI_CSIS1		0x11890000
 
+#define EXYNOS4_PA_FIMD0		0x11C00000
+#define EXYNOS4_PA_FIMD1		0x12000000
+
 #define EXYNOS4_PA_HSMMC(x)		(0x12510000 + ((x) * 0x10000))
 
 #define EXYNOS4_PA_SATA			0x12560000
@@ -140,6 +143,8 @@
 #define S5P_PA_FIMC3			EXYNOS4_PA_FIMC3
 #define S5P_PA_MIPI_CSIS0		EXYNOS4_PA_MIPI_CSIS0
 #define S5P_PA_MIPI_CSIS1		EXYNOS4_PA_MIPI_CSIS1
+#define S5P_PA_FIMD0			EXYNOS4_PA_FIMD0
+#define S5P_PA_FIMD1			EXYNOS4_PA_FIMD1
 #define S5P_PA_ONENAND			EXYNOS4_PA_ONENAND
 #define S5P_PA_ONENAND_DMA		EXYNOS4_PA_ONENAND_DMA
 #define S5P_PA_SDRAM			EXYNOS4_PA_SDRAM
